Water conservation slogans mandatory on Bhopal's hoardings

This summer, advertising hoardings across Bhopal have been emblazoned with slogans such as "Pani se hota hai kalyan kahtain ye Ved Quran" (Water is the key to prosperity say the Vedas and the Quran). Faced with an acute water crisis, the Bhopal Municipal Corporation (bmc) has made it mandatory for every hoarding to have slogans on water conservation.

There are over 3,000 hoardings in the city. As of now 33 carry the message. The idea is to create awareness among the people, bmc commissioner Manish Singh said. The level of water consumption from wells, tube wells, tanks and rivers is being reviewed. An inventory of water available is also being prepared, Madhya Pradesh's public health engineering minister Rampal Singh said.
